Sheikh Ossama, the Imam at ICM, spoke today at UU. What a pleasure! My first time meeting him. He spoke on Ramadan and did questions and answers on all topics. I found the entire experience so interesting and enlivening. He seems like a knowledgeable, compassionate man with great integrity and strong opinions. I am fascinated to hear other peoples perspectives, I feel it really helps me grow as a person. Two things that especially resonated with me, if one loves the Creator, then one must love all His creations. Love of God/Divinity precludes hate of others. Another thing he said, which echoed exactly what I was talking about yesterday with some church folk, was that we emphasize our differences too much. We are so much more the same than we are different. We are only different in the details. We all want the same things in life: to be free, to be safe, to love, our children to be safe, healthy, and happy, shelter, home, food, water. In these respects, we are all very much the same. It seems like it should be so easy for all the world to meet on common ground and resolve conflict. It seems to me that peace has to be a much easier path to walk. I am so grateful that UUFM brings in these wonderful speakers. Each speaker may not resonate with every person but I think it gives us a rainbow of diversity of perspectives to challenge us, make us think, and polish our rough edges.
